Webb5 apr. 2024 · Corrugated sheet metal roofing costs $5 to $12 per square foot installed. A standing seam metal roof costs $9 to $16 per square foot installed. A tin roof costs $6 to $18 per square foot installed. Installing a steel roof costs $5 to $13 per square foot for galvanized or galvalume metal. Webb17 maj 2024 · Concealed fastener panels typically cover 16-18” whereas exposed fastener panels routinely cover 36”. That simple difference means the panel manufacturer and the installer experience significantly reduced efficiency when working with concealed fastener panels. Transportation Costs .
